About Relaxed Screenings

Relaxed Screenings have sensory-friendly adjustments which aim to reduce over-stimulation and create a relaxed and welcoming environment for those who might need it. Relaxed Screenings particularly appeal to autistic, learning disabled and neurodivergent visitors, along with their friends, family, or support. Relaxed screenings include the following adjustments:
  • Tickets are limited to reduce the number of people in the cinema
  • Visitors are free to move around the space as needed
  • No trailers are shown
  • The hand dryers in the Sky Room toilets are switched off
  • Lighting is kept at a slightly higher level
  • Opening and closing slides to the film are played to support transition
